use std::ops::RangeInclusive;
pub(crate) struct XmlChSRange {
pub(crate) range: RangeInclusive<u16>,
}
pub(crate) struct XmlChLRange {
pub(crate) range: RangeInclusive<u32>,
}
pub struct XmlChRangeGroup {
pub(crate) short_range: &'static [XmlChSRange],
pub(crate) long_range: &'static [XmlChLRange],
}
pub(crate) fn xml_char_in_range(val: u32, rptr: &XmlChRangeGroup) -> bool {
if val < 0x10000 {
if rptr.short_range.is_empty() {
return false;
}
let sptr = rptr.short_range;
let (mut low, mut high) = (0, sptr.len());
while high - low > 1 {
let mid = (high + low) / 2;
if val < *sptr[mid].range.start() as u32 {
high = mid;
} else if val > *sptr[mid].range.end() as u32 {
low = mid;
} else {
return true;
}
}
sptr[low].range.contains(&(val as u16))
} else {
if rptr.long_range.is_empty() {
return false;
}
let lptr = rptr.long_range;
let (mut low, mut high) = (0, lptr.len());
while high - low > 1 {
let mid = (high + low) / 2;
if val < *lptr[mid].range.start() {
high = mid;
} else if val > *lptr[mid].range.end() {
low = mid;
} else {
return true;
}
}
lptr[low].range.contains(&val)
}
}

pub(crate) trait XmlCharValid {
fn is_xml_char(&self) -> bool;
fn is_xml_base_char(&self) -> bool;
fn is_xml_blank_char(&self) -> bool;
fn is_xml_pubid_char(&self) -> bool;
fn is_xml_combining(&self) -> bool;
fn is_xml_digit(&self) -> bool;
fn is_xml_extender(&self) -> bool;
fn is_xml_ideographic(&self) -> bool;
}
impl XmlCharValid for u8 {
#[doc(alias = "xmlIsCharCh")]
fn is_xml_char(&self) -> bool {
(0x9..=0xa).contains(self) || *self == 0xd || 0x20 <= *self
}
#[doc(alias = "XmlIsBaseCharCh")]
fn is_xml_base_char(&self) -> bool {
(0x41..=0x5a).contains(self)
|| (0x61..=0x7a).contains(self)
|| (0xc0..=0xd6).contains(self)
|| (0xd8..=0xf6).contains(self)
|| 0xf8 <= *self
}
#[doc(alias = "XmlIsBlankCh")]
fn is_xml_blank_char(&self) -> bool {
*self == 0x20 || (0x9..=0xa).contains(self) || *self == 0xd
}
#[doc(alias = "xmlIsPubidChar_ch")]
fn is_xml_pubid_char(&self) -> bool {
XML_IS_PUBID_CHAR_TAB[*self as usize]
}
fn is_xml_combining(&self) -> bool {
false
}
#[doc(alias = "xmlIsDigit_ch")]
fn is_xml_digit(&self) -> bool {
self.is_ascii_digit()
}
#[doc(alias = "xmlIsExtender_ch")]
fn is_xml_extender(&self) -> bool {
*self == 0xb7
}
fn is_xml_ideographic(&self) -> bool {
false
}
}
impl XmlCharValid for u32 {
#[doc(alias = "xmlIsCharQ")]
fn is_xml_char(&self) -> bool {
if *self < 0x100 {
(*self as u8).is_xml_char()
} else {
(0x100..=0xd7ff).contains(self)
|| (0xe000..=0xfffd).contains(self)
|| (0x10000..=0x10ffff).contains(self)
}
}
#[doc(alias = "xmlIsBaseCharQ")]
fn is_xml_base_char(&self) -> bool {
if *self < 0x100 {
(*self as u8).is_xml_base_char()
} else {
xml_char_in_range(*self, &XML_IS_BASE_CHAR_GROUP)
}
}
#[doc(alias = "xmlIsBlankQ")]
fn is_xml_blank_char(&self) -> bool {
*self < 0x100 && (*self as u8).is_xml_blank_char()
}
#[doc = "xmlIsPubidCharQ"]
fn is_xml_pubid_char(&self) -> bool {
*self < 0x100 && (*self as u8).is_xml_pubid_char()
}
#[doc(alias = "xmlIsCombiningQ")]
fn is_xml_combining(&self) -> bool {
if *self < 0x100 {
false
} else {
xml_char_in_range(*self, &XML_IS_COMBINING_GROUP)
}
}
#[doc(alias = "xmlIsDigitQ")]
fn is_xml_digit(&self) -> bool {
if *self < 0x100 {
(*self as u8).is_xml_digit()
} else {
xml_char_in_range(*self, &XML_IS_DIGIT_GROUP)
}
}
#[doc(alias = "xmlIsExtenderQ")]
fn is_xml_extender(&self) -> bool {
if *self < 0x100 {
(*self as u8).is_xml_extender()
} else {
xml_char_in_range(*self, &XML_IS_EXTENDER_GROUP)
}
}
#[doc(alias = "xmlIsIdeographicQ")]
fn is_xml_ideographic(&self) -> bool {
if *self < 0x100 {
false
} else {
(0x4e00..=0x9fa5).contains(self) || *self == 0x3007 || (0x3021..=0x3029).contains(self)
}
}
}
